Professor Gary A. Speck conducts the Miami University Wind Ensemble and the
Ensemble of New Music, as well as teaching conducting and music education. Studying at Baylor and the University of Michigan (M.M., 1982), he served as a public school band conductor in his home state of Texas and as a graduate teaching assistant at Michigan and the Cincinnati College-Conservatory of Music. Mr. Speck has won praise from Pulitzer Prize-winning composers such as Karel Husa and Leslie Bassett for performances of their music, and has issued a compact disc recording, "American Music for Wind Ensemble," with the Miami University Wind Ensemble.
